Karmic Angels presents football items to JFC

Dec 19, 2011, 1:33 PM | Article By: Lamin Drammeh

Karmic Angels, a registered charitable organisation in The Gambia, has continued to render invaluable support to Gambian sport, particularly football.

The organisation under the guidance of Alan and Stephanie Turner, at the weekend donated a set of football Jerseys to the Jiffarong Football Club (JFC) at a ceremony held at the team’s training centre in Buffer Zone, Fajikunda.

The materials were donated to the JFC thanks to the connection of Bekai Njie, senior reporter at the Daily Observe newspaper, who is also a native of the village and a friend to the British couple.

The items, which also included three footballs, was received on behalf of the  team by Jerreh Kinteh, head coach of the Lower River Region outfit, whose charges were also in attendance to receive the materials with excitement.

The team expressed hope that the items would make a significant contribution in their career as the team members have made several unsuccessful efforts over the years to secure proper football materials.

Speaking to Pointsport shortly after the presentation, Alan said the materials would give more confidence to members of the team. “None of them will wear different jerseys any more for matches,” he added.

The lover of youth and sport also said the primary reason they are contributing to football development in The Gambia is because it is the leading sport in the country and that their contribution will help the boys to be dedicated and continue to take up football with all seriousness.
